A 77-year-old man has died after a rare kangaroo attack in remote southwest Australia. Photo / APA man who may have been keeping a wild kangaroo as a pet was killed by the animal in southwest Australia, police said. It was reportedly the first fatal attack by a kangaroo in Australia since 1936. Police believe the victim had been keeping the wild kangaroo as a pet.
